Guest TheZsaszHorsemen Report post Posted March 19, 2003 The title is rather self-explanitory. Where did the idea for your characters come from? Yourself? TV or Movies? Comic books? History? Telling about a character's inspiration will make it a bit asier for other people to write your character. ZsasZ: I just wanted to do something different. The idea of a character who fought with his mind, and who was driven by an unkown goal that seemed rather sinister was just cool. It could work in film, in TV, in comics. It just happens to be written for an e-fed. He kinda grew out of The Man With No Name in a way. The "lone-wolf" type. He also has a bit of Patrick Bateman in him, the way everything is a mental choice for him. He could shake your hand or he could hit you over the head with a chair. He has no morals. The Gladiator: I wanted another mystery man. I also wanted to explore the simalarities between ancient Rome and professional wrestling. I also enjoy teasing that he is/was a real Gladiator. (The Highlander song, the promos) I also wanted to do a guy where the crowd will play an active role in the match. The crowd's role is simalar to Ceasar's in the Colluseum. They'll decided whther the heel has "had enough" or he should continue to suffer. I also thought a man who saw every conflict as a face-to-face battle would be an outstanding contrast to a man who sees every action as a possible backstabbing. Who fights from the shadows. Guest Tony149 Report post Posted March 19, 2003 Tony "The Body": This was supposed to be a mix of two of my favorite wrestlers/personalities (Jesse "The Body" Ventura & "Ravishing" Rick Rude). I didn't really write many of my promos, others did, mainly because I didn't really know how to write them. It wasn't until I helped co-write a (fan) script, last fall, that I really started to understand how to go about writing for a character. Over the past month I've become more involved than before in the writing process (promos/matches), and am very pleased with my work. If I could do it over, I would of done more in my early days writing for my character. The Purist: I got the basic idea behind The Purist (upset in the direction wrestling has gone in; anti-sports entertainment) after seeing threads - which turned into debates and flames - about former WWF/WCW; current NWA: TNA writer, Vince Russo, and his views on wrestling. I thought doing a character playing off many fans' love for Chris Benoit and Japanese wrestling, would be something fun. And it has. Now I've added well-known anti-sports entertainment/Vince Russo personality, Jim Cornette as the manager of The Purist. Share this post Link to post Share on other sites

Hmmmm, all the OAOAST characters/gimmicks I've done, eh? ol' skool evenflowDDT - straight Raven rip-off. With the flannel and everything. WITH RAVEN AS MANAGER~ Scott Levy would be ashamed of having a fan who shamelessly ripped him off so much In Crowd evenflowDDT - I always wanted to be a cocky preppy in real life, despite heavily disliking such characters (or rather, the stereotypes of them, since I've only met a couple - who embodied the majority of those stereotypes, unfortunately) in reality. So, I played a cocky preppy who could back up what he said, which would make me hate the real cocky preppies less. It was fun, but hard to keep fresh. I give Zack and later Superstar ALL the credit for keeping the In Crowd going as long as it did and still making it a ton of fun. It worked so well that I talk to them online all the time (OK, I'm not on AIM that much, but, y'know) and consider them true friends that I'd love to save up and fly out to see some day. Repentant evenflowDDT - OK, this was something I wanted to try around the time of "the end" between my long-running feud with Sandman and the King of the Deathmatch tournament, where basically I had this martyr personality and didn't want to hurt anyone. I thought it'd be interesting, but somehow not wrestling doesn't work too well on a wrestling show. I know. Ingrate fans w/ no respect for a deep character... Freaky Pseudo-Religious evenflowDDT - This is an extension of Repentant evenflowDDT, and they both sorta meshed together in the beginning. I started to make non-specific dark religious and spiritual allusions. It also began establishing myself as crazy, and I started to distance myself from Zack and Alison as I tried to regain a foothold on reality. Just when you thought it was safe... THE GOLEM~! - My vision of a religious heel. It worked so well on paper. The only problem? I was a face. Whoops. I also didn't really take the time to research specific biblical passages and references, but it worked out really well for about a week or so, unfortunately, I let it "degrade" from specific references/foreboding maniacal evil stuff to "I wasn't created in the image of man, and share not his fallible soul, thus I am perfect in the image of God", which was essentially the same promo every week. I had originally gotten the idea of The Golem not just from Jewish folklore, but also from an essay I read in my Muppet Magic class by Heinrich Kleist about the Uber-Marionette... basically he goes off for 30 pages on how emotion ruins human acting performances and theorizes that the greatest performance in the history of theatre would be put on by 5-foot puppets, the uber-marionettes, because they could be perfect whereas a human's performance will always be marred by his emotion. Weird. Also, as face, I envisioned the idea that I'd be more like The Golem of Jewish folklore, where I'd be the "protector" of the Jews in the ghetto (the OAOASTers) against their oppressors (the aWo), but I never really got around to talking to anyone about it so that never worked either. HEEEEEEEEEL evenflowDDT - This is where I revealed, SWERVE~! that it was really OAOAST jobber James Blonde in The Golem suit and I was playing everyone for suckers. I had simply taken longer to recover, that's all. I also began to become a prick and, embellishing too much in my riches, eventually alienated my best friend Zack, who was putting a lot of energy into finally winning the title. But we were still together, until... Royal Rumble heel split evenflowDDT - Zack ATTACKS~! I don't want to fight Zack at the Royal Rumble because he's still my friend, but there ends up being a skirmish between us and he eliminates me. I demand an explanation, and get so worked up over it that I lose Alison, end the long-running friendship between myself and Zack, and due to a fluke, lose all my money. As Zack goes on to glory and main-eventing Anglemania, I let my hatred of him grow and become the best at me such that I can't even win a match anymore and don't even sign up for a match at the PPV. Yet, at the same time, it's very subtly suggested that despite my blaming him for my current misfortunes, that I still wouldn't really fight Zack if given the chance. It's more or less like I just want him to admit he was wrong, but I think now it's gone too far for that. It's also (much less subtly) apparent that my grip on reality/sanity is slipping again. How low can you go? How much can one lose and still remain faithful? Guess we'll just have to wait and see... The many faces of evenflow! Now then, a couple that never were, and maybe will be...
